Details for Megadeth's highly anticipated 15th studio album have finally been revealed! Dystopia is scheduled for a Jan. 22, 2016 release date and the album art and full track listing are now available for your gazing eyes.

Megadeth's follow-up to Super Collider is the first to feature Angra guitarist Kiko Loureiro and Lamb of God drummer Chris Adler. Megadeth went down to Nashville, Tenn. to record Dystopia with Toby Wright (Lamb of God / Gojira) and frontman Dave Mustaine serving as producers.

The Dystopia artwork shows longtime Megadeth mascot Vic Rattlehead in a chaotic cityscape brandishing a samurai sword and holding the head of a robotic enemy. Taking a quick look at the album's track listing, the theme of dystopia seems to permeate the entire record with songs like "The Threat is Real," "Post American World" and "Conquer or Die."

"There's a lot of riffing going on in there, that's for damn sure," Dave Mustaine recently told Revolver. "There's a lot of solos, a lot of pounding drums and bass. I knew from the start that I wanted to go back to my roots, and I wanted to make a thrash record."

Megadeth, Dystopia Track Listing:

01. The Threat Is Real
02. Dystopia
03. Fatal Illusion
04. Death From Within
05. Bullet To The Brain
06. Post American World
07. Poisonous Shadows
08. Look Who's Talking
09. Conquer Or Die
10. Lying In State
11. The Emperor
12. Last Dying Wish
13. Foreign Policy (FEAR cover)
